ACHE 2018 Concurrent Sessions

Post Traditional Graduate Students – Insights for Program Development and Marketing

Monday, October 8, 2018 at 3:00 PM–4:00 PM EDT
Newport
Session Description

Post-traditional graduate students comprise almost 80% of the graduate market. Attendees will review data from a 2018 national survey profiling these students’ demands and preferences. Discussion will focus on how findings can be applied to marketing, outreach, and program development efforts, in order to ensure institutions are connecting effectively with graduate students.

Primary Presenter

Carol Aslanian, Aslanian Market Research, EducationDynamics
Brief Bio

Carol B. Aslanian is founder and president of Aslanian Market Research. She is a national authority on the characteristics and learning patterns of adult and post-traditional undergraduate and graduate students. She has made hundreds of presentations and has authored numerous articles and reports on the topic. For more than 20 years, she worked at the College Board in support of adult learning services. Ms. Aslanian has led market research projects for more than 300 colleges, universities, and educational agencies.

Presenter #2

Scott Jeffe, Aslanian Market Research, EducationDynamics
Brief Bio:

Scott Jeffe is Senior Director of Aslanian Market Research, and has been Carol Aslanian’s research partner for 21 years. He is responsible for the management of AMR’s institutional market research studies, professional development seminars, and national research projects on adult, post-traditional, and online students learning patterns. He has managed research projects for more than 125 colleges and universities and organized more than 40 professional development programs.
